Can I change my company name after incorporation?

Yes, a company name can be changed any time after the incorporation.

Companies change their registered name for many reasons. Examples of this include:

  • Change of company direction
  • Rebranding
  • Sale of company
  • Error in company name
  • Name too similar to another business
  • Renaming a shelf company

These are just a few examples and not an exhaustive list.

Changing a company name can be quite simple. Using Companies House online filing you can submit form NM01 and change the company name in just a few hours. Alternatively you can file a paper version of this form.

Companies House charge an administration fee for all company name changes.

Any change of name will be recorded in the records at Companies House. You cannot hide this information from the public. However, for most companies this is not a problem. Many large companies have changed their company name in the past. In addition, customers do not normally go searching through Companies House records.
